Aleksander Dżuryło

lawyer
Immigration law, administrative proceedings, administrative court proceedings

Aleksander Dżuryło provides comprehensive advice to employers on hiring foreigners and legalising their stay in Poland. He conducts and supervises projects involving local hiring and posting of employees by foreign employers. He also specialises in the procedure for acquiring or renouncing Polish citizenship.

In addition, he advises on certain issues relevant to individual and collective labour law.

He has been involved with immigration law, administrative procedure, and administrative court procedure since the beginning of his career. He acquired experience at the Province Administrative Court in Warsaw and in some of the biggest HR law firms.

He leads training for foreigners and some of the largest Polish and foreign employers, in English, Polish, Ukrainian and Russian. He is the author or co-author of articles published in the Polish and foreign press.
